The Second Annual Port City Dog Runners Canicross Classic
Join us at Little River Reservoir in Saint John, NB for our fall dryland event!
Where: Saint John, NB
When: Saturday, October 29th, 2022
What: All racers will start in the first 3km race (a two up start system will be used). You can then choose to take on the challenge of doing a second 3 km loop once the first race is finished. The second race can be completed with the same dog or with a different dog.
The Area: The race start, participant meeting, and sign-in will all be held in the immediate area of the parking lot, the little river reservoir also has a lake to cool off in and a bark park onsite.
Parking: Parking is available on site.
Regional Circuit: This event forms part of the MAHDS Regional Circuit and will count toward year-end canicross standings. The series will continue into the 2023 Spring Dryland calendar and year-end standings will be determined at the end of the Spring race calendar.

Route Map
The Route: The Rez is flat, fast, easy to follow. It is a mix of crushed gravel, grass and has 4 wooden bridges to cross throughout the single 3km loop. There will be no head on passing.

Gear Requirements
Required Equipment:
Dogs: All dogs MUST be in a harness designed for running and pulling. Dogs must be 12 months of age for events 5km or longer. Dogs must be 10 months of age to compete in events up to a distance of 2km.
Canicross: A canicross belt & bungee line is strongly recommended though any hands-free running leash will be acceptable. The distance from the competitor's abdomen to the base of the tail of the dog must be at most 2 meters, when tight without elongation. However, the recommended distance is 1.70 meters. As this race is a MAHDS sanctioned event, this competition will utilize the MAHDS race rules.
Rules:
Because harness dog sports involve more than human athletes, our rules for participants incorporate more than the expected rules to ensure fair competition. These rules also address factors that can impact the health and safety of our canine and human teammates - things like the age of the dog for competition, sport-specific gear requirements for humans and dogs, trail rules (such as passing), and good sportsmanship.
